What Does a Car Locksmith Do?
A car locksmith concentrates on automotive security. They are trained to manage a wide range of issues associated with locks, keys, and security systems in cars. Here are a few of the primary services they offer:
Key Replacement and Duplication
- Lost or Stolen Keys: If a car owner loses their keys, a locksmith can produce a brand-new set using the vehicle's distinct key code or by decoding the lock.
- Replicate Keys: Creating an extra set of keys for benefit or for relative.
Key Extraction
- Broken Keys: Sometimes keys break off inside the lock. A car locksmith has the know-how to safely extract the broken key without harming the lock.
Lock Repair and Replacement
- Damaged Locks: If a car lock is damaged due to use and tear or an attempted break-in, a locksmith can repair or replace it.
- Rekeying: Changing the internal pins of a lock to make it deal with a new set of keys, ensuring the old keys no longer work.
High-Security Key Services
- Transponder Keys: Modern automobiles frequently use transponder keys, which have a chip that communicates with the car's security system. Car locksmith professionals can program and replace these keys.
- Remote Car Keys: Repairing or replacing remote car keys, consisting of those with incorporated keyless entry systems.
Car Lockout Assistance
- Emergency situation Lockout: If you lock yourself out of your car, a locksmith can rapidly and safely open the vehicle.
- Trunk Lockout: Assistance with opening the trunk if you accidentally lock your keys within.
Ignition Repair and Replacement
- Damaged Ignitions: Over time, the ignition switch can break, making it tough to begin the car. A locksmith can repair or replace the ignition switch.
Keyless Entry Systems
- Setup and Programming: Installing and programming keyless entry systems for added benefit and security.
Vehicle Security Consultation
- Security Assessments: Providing recommendations on enhancing the security of your vehicle, consisting of recommendations for additional locks or alarms.
Tools of the Trade
Car locksmiths utilize a variety of specialized tools to perform their jobs efficiently and effectively. Here are some of the essential tools in their toolbox:
- Key Cutting Machines: These makers can replicate keys rapidly and accurately.
- Lock Decoder: A device utilized to determine the key code for a lock.
- Lock Picking Tools: For emergency lockouts, locksmith professionals use these tools to open locks without triggering damage.
- Transponder Key Programmer: This device is utilized to program transponder keys to work with a car's security system.
- Laser Key Cutting Machine: For high-precision key cutting, particularly for intricate key designs.
- Ignition Cylinder Puller: A tool utilized to eliminate the ignition cylinder for repair or replacement.
- Pin Extractors: Used to get rid of broken pins from locks during repairs.

Frequently Asked Questions About Car Locksmiths
Q: How do I discover a trusted car locksmith?
- A: Look for locksmith professionals with accreditations from professional companies such as the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A). Read online evaluations and request for referrals from good friends or family. Constantly check for a license and insurance before employing a locksmith.
Q: Can a car locksmith open my car without damaging it?
- A: Yes, expert car locksmith professionals utilize specialized tools and strategies to open locks without triggering damage. They are trained to manage a variety of lock types and can generally get to your vehicle rapidly and securely.
Q: How long does it require to have a brand-new key made?
- A: The time it requires to make a brand-new key depends upon the kind of key and the complexity of the lock. Basic key duplications can take just a few minutes, while transponder key programming might take longer, often 30 minutes to an hour.
Q: Is it legal to have a locksmith make a key for my car?
- A: Yes, it is legal as long as you can show ownership of the vehicle. A lot of locksmith professionals will require identification and a valid factor for needing a new key.
Q: Can car locksmith professionals program modern keyless entry systems?
- A: Yes, numerous car locksmiths are geared up to program and install keyless entry systems. They have the required tools and knowledge to make sure that your brand-new system works seamlessly with your vehicle.

The Future of Car Locksmithing
As innovation advances, the role of the car locksmith is developing. Modern lorries are progressively geared up with advanced security systems, consisting of keyless entry and smart key technology. Car locksmiths are continuously upgrading their skills and getting brand-new tools to keep up with these advancements. Here are some trends to see:
- Increased Use of Smart Technology: More automobiles are featuring incorporated clever systems that can be accessed via mobile phones or other devices.
- Biometric Locks: Some luxury cars are explore biometric locks, such as finger print or facial acknowledgment, which will need customized understanding from locksmiths.
- Remote Services: With the rise of mobile innovation, car locksmiths are offering more remote services, such as key programming through smart device apps.
